• Fried Zucchini Chips with Tzatziki

    ❂ Ingredients:

    2 medium zucchinis
    2 cups all-purpose flour
    Pot of ice-cold water
    1 teaspoon salt (adjust to taste)
    Vegetable oil for frying

    ❂ Cooking process:

    1 Wash the zucchinis and cut them into thin slices, about 1,5 mm-2 mm thick.
    2 Place the sliced zucchini in ice-cold salted water.
    3 Dredge the zucchini slices in flour, ensuring each piece is evenly coated. Next, quickly dip them into ice water—this step will help maintain their crispness.
    4 Finally, fry the slices in hot oil (350F)until golden and crispy. This method ensures the zucchini retains a delightful crunch.
    5 Remove the zucchini chips from the oil and place them on a plate lined with paper towels to drain excess oil.
    6 Serve hot, optionally with a sprinkle of extra salt and a tzatziki sauce for dipping.

    For Tzatziki Sauce

    2 cups Greek yogurt
    1 medium cucumber, grated and drained
    2 cloves garlic, minced
    2 tbsp olive oil
    1 tbsp lemon juice
    1/2 tsp dry mint
    Salt and pepper, to taste
